Database Design Considerations

Architecture

Database design within this context necessitates a tiered approach, separating transaction data from analytical data to optimize query performance and maintain data integrity. Scalability is paramount, anticipating increasing volumes of trades and derivative valuations, demanding horizontally scalable database solutions. Real-time data ingestion pipelines are critical, utilizing technologies capable of handling high-frequency market data feeds from cryptocurrency exchanges and traditional financial sources. Consideration must be given to immutable data storage for audit trails and regulatory compliance, potentially leveraging blockchain-inspired data structures.